Pethericks Corners is a locality in Northumberland, Ontario, Canada. It is classified as a village / hamlet. Pethericks Corners is located at 44.3533°N, 77.7339°W. It observes Eastern Time (UTC−5 / −4). Postal code area: K0K.
Pethericks Corners occupies a quiet, unassuming position tucked against the rise of Ferris Hill, where the land holds the weight of the ancient bedrock beneath a thin skin of soil. It lies 21.2 km north-west of Quinte West, ON (from Quinte West, ON: bearing 325°T), and is situated 6.9 km north-east of Campbellford. The Crowe River carves its path nearby, pulling the eye toward the water’s dark, persistent movement, while the presence of Mud Lake, situated three kilometers away, adds a stillness to the surrounding air that softens the edge of the horizon.
